Any strategies for dealing with Alamo at MCO? I was thinking DH goes to pick up the car and I get the luggage. Last time the wait was nuts. Thanks. Deb
 
If you sign up for q u i c k s i l v e r (Alamo's free member club) you shouldn't have to wait, just go out to the lot and pick out your car! That's what we are planning!

If you both want to be able to drive the car, you will both have to go to the counter. They have to see each person's driver's license and each person signs the rental agreement.

not if you're both on the master rental agreement that QS has onfile; along with your company's CC info...quick check-in @ kiosk.
 

You might still have to wait...there can be LONG lines to get out of the garage at peak times.
 
Alternate strategy for Alamo at MCO: Bring your rental agreement (and proof of insurance, if you're planning to refuse it) one counter to the left to L & M. Chances are, they will match the price.
 
If you have a discount,you can't always use q u i c k s i l v e r. Just go to the parking garage and on the second floor there's a glass booth for national and alamo. There are hardly any people in line.

We used the on-line check in. We gathered our luggage on a cart, went out to the garage, picked out a vehicle, loaded up, and gave our credit card at the kiosk at the exit from the garage. It went really smooth for us.

There was a long line when we picked up on 1-10-07 in the morning. They do have the online machines where you can check in and be on your way a lot quicker than waiting in line. We just gave them our coupon at the gate when we were leaving. Using the computers was a bit easier, but just make sure you read each screen carefully so that you select the correct option.
